About Venergy Solar
Venergy Solar is a national renewable energy company specialising in the design, supply and installation of solar, battery and EV charging solutions for residential and commercial customers across South Australia, Victoria, Western Australia and New South Wales.
With a strong reputation for quality, service and long-term performance, Venergy manages the full customer journey - from initial consultation and system design through to installation, grid connection, compliance, commissioning and after-sales support. Our mission is to make solar easy while delivering premium solutions that customers can trust.
About the Role
We are seeking a highly organised and detail-oriented Project Administrator to support the successful delivery of solar ,battery and EV charging projects across the business.
This role is critical in helping coordinate installations, manage project documentation, support communication between internal teams and customers, and ensure projects progress efficiently through each stage of delivery. The ideal candidate will understand the fast-moving nature of the renewable energy industry and be confident managing multiple tasks across residential and commercial projects.
Key Responsibilities
Support the coordination of solar, battery and EV charger installation projects from handover through to completion.
Work closely with internal teams including sales, operations, scheduling, procurement, installation and customer service to ensure smooth project delivery.
Liaise with customers, suppliers, installers, electricians, network providers and other stakeholders to assist with project progress and issue resolution.
Monitor project timelines and milestones, ensuring jobs move efficiently through design approval, procurement, installation, grid application, commissioning and handover stages.
Prepare, review and maintain project documentation including work orders, compliance documents, site information, variation requests, commissioning records and handover documents.
Assist with scheduling and tracking installations, ensuring materials, labour and project requirements are aligned ahead of install dates.
Support variation management where project scope changes due to site conditions, customer requests or technical requirements.
Help maintain accurate project records and data across internal systems to support reporting, operational visibility and continuous improvement.
Provide clear and professional communication to customers throughout the project lifecycle, helping create a high-quality customer experience.
Assist management with project reporting, internal updates, performance tracking and identification of process improvement opportunities.
Contribute to post-installation reviews and help identify lessons learned to improve future delivery outcomes.
